    88:1 A Song, a Psalm, by sons of Korah, to the Overseer, `Concerning the Sickness of Afflictions.' -- An instruction, by Heman the Ezrahite. O Jehovah, God of my salvation, Daily I have cried, nightly before Thee,

    88:2 My prayer cometh in before Thee, Incline Thine ear to my loud cry,

    88:3 For my soul hath been full of evils, And my life hath come to Sheol.

    88:4 I have been reckoned with those going down [to] the pit, I have been as a man without strength.

    88:5 Among the dead -- free, As pierced ones lying in the grave, Whom Thou hast not remembered any more, Yea, they by Thy hand have been cut off.

    88:6 Thou hast put me in the lowest pit, In dark places, in depths.

    88:7 Upon me hath Thy fury lain, And [with] all Thy breakers Thou hast afflicted. Selah.

    88:8 Thou hast put mine acquaintance far from me, Thou hast made me an abomination to them, Shut up -- I go not forth.

    88:9 Mine eye hath grieved because of affliction, I called Thee, O Jehovah, all the day, I have spread out unto Thee my hands.

    88:10 To the dead dost Thou do wonders? Do Rephaim rise? do they thank Thee? Selah.

    88:11 Is Thy kindness recounted in the grave? Thy faithfulness in destruction?

    88:12 Are Thy wonders known in the darkness? And Thy righteousness in the land of forgetfulness?

    88:13 And I, unto Thee, O Jehovah, I have cried, And in the morning doth my prayer come before Thee.

    88:14 Why, O Jehovah, castest Thou off my soul? Thou hidest Thy face from me.

    88:15 I [am] afflicted, and expiring from youth, I have borne Thy terrors -- I pine away.

    88:16 Over me hath Thy wrath passed, Thy terrors have cut me off,

    88:17 They have surrounded me as waters all the day, They have gone round against me together,

    88:18 Thou hast put far from me lover and friend, Mine acquaintance [is] the place of darkness!
